What is the difference between Tosca Automation Testing vs Selenium Automation Tester?

AspectTosca Automation TestingSelenium Automation Tester
Primary FocusModel-based test automation for enterprise applicationsScript-based web application testing using Selenium WebDriver
Required SkillsTosca tools, test case design, basic scriptingJava/Python, Selenium WebDriver, programming skills
Work EnvironmentEnterprise testing teams, QA departmentsWeb development and testing teams, QA departments
CertificationsTricentis Tosca certificationsISTQB, Selenium certifications

While Tosca Automation Testing offers a model-based approach suitable for large-scale enterprise testing with minimal scripting, Selenium Automation Tester focuses on scripting-based web testing, providing flexibility for web application automation. Both roles are essential in QA teams but differ in tools, skills, and application scope.

What is Tosca Automation Testing?

Tosca Automation Testing refers to the use of the Tosca tool, developed by Tricentis, to automate software testing processes. Tosca enables testers to create, manage, and execute automated test cases for various applications, including web, mobile, and enterprise solutions. It supports model-based test automation, which allows for more efficient and maintainable test creation compared to traditional scripting methods. Tosca also provides features like risk-based testing, test data management, and integration with CI/CD pipelines, making it a popular choice for agile and DevOps te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Tosca Automation Testing professional, and why are they important?

To excel in Tosca Automation Testing, you need a solid understanding of software testing concepts, test case design, and experience with Tosca TestSuite, often supported by a background in computer science or software engineering. Familiarity with Tosca modules, test automation frameworks, and integration with tools like Jira or Jenkins is typically required, along with Tricentis Tosca certification being adv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help testers collaborate with teams and interpret complex test results. These competencies ensure the creation of reliable automated test processes, leading to higher software quality and efficient delivery.

How does a Tosca Automation Tester typically collaborate with development and QA teams during a software release cycle?

Tosca Automation Testers work closely with both development and QA teams to ensure automated test coverage aligns with project requirements. They frequently participate in sprint planning meetings to understand upcoming features, coordinate on test case creation, and share feedback from automated test results. Effective communication is key, as testers help developers identify defects early and work with QA leads to prioritize test scenarios. This collaborative approach helps streamline the release process and improves overall software quality.
